Raymond H. Smith
Associate Professor of Music
Raymond H. Smith,Associate Professor of Music, joined the Troy University faculty in the fall of 1990. Mr. Smith is a graduate of Troy State and the University of South Florida with degrees in music education and performance.
Raymond Smith has more than thirty years of public school and university teaching experience. During his public school teaching career, Mr. Smith's bands consistently received acclaim at state, regional, and national events.
Mr. Smith has served as a clinician, adjudicator, soloist, recitalist and conductor for bands, school sysstems, and music organizations throughout the South. Raymond Smith has presented clinics for the Georgia Music Educators Association, the Florida Bandmasters Association, the National Music Educators Conference, as well as many band, school systems, and arts organizations.
Among the honors Mr. Smith received are: Teacher of the Year, Outstanding Leader in Elementary and Secondary Education, Outstanding Service Award for the American Cancer Society, and Service Award by the NAACP.
Mr. Smith has been featured soloist with the Troy University Symphony Band on many occasions. Raymond Smith's other professional credits include performances with the Florida Orchestra, Tampa Bay Symphony, Gulf Coast Symphony, Sarasota Opera, Tampa Ballet, Moscow Ballet, Joffrey Ballet, Barnum and Bailey Circus, and many Broadway musicals.
Raymond H. Smith is currently director of the “Sound of the South” Concert Band, the Jazz Chamber Ensemble, and he is professor of woodwinds. |
